What level of education is required to become a radiology technician in Washington?

To become a radiology technician in Washington, the typical educational requirement is completing a two-year associate degree from a JRCERT-accredited program, usually offered at community colleges or technical schools. While becoming a radiologist requires additional advanced education and specialized training, radiology technicians gain essential skills through these accredited programs in anatomy, patient care, radiation physics, and clinical practicum.

Washington does not require state licensure for radiology technicians, but most employers expect candidates to hold certification from the American Registry of Radiologic Technologists (ARRT). This national certification emphasizes passing a standardized exam, which may or may not fully capture practical skills. Given the competitive job market with around 1,800 positions, pursuing advanced certifications or continuing education can provide a significant advantage for job seekers in the state.

How much can radiology technicians earn in Washington?

Radiology technicians in Washington State earn competitive salaries that reflect their specialized skills and the region's demand for healthcare professionals. The average annual salary for a radiology technician in Washington is approximately $84,592, with a typical range between $70,000 and $103,000 per year. Factors such as experience, education, and specific certifications can influence where an individual falls within this range.

In metropolitan areas like Seattle and Bellevue, salaries tend to be higher due to the cost of living and concentration of healthcare facilities. For instance, positions in these cities often offer base salaries ranging from $73,000 to $107,000 annually. Additional compensation, including bonuses and shift differentials, can further increase total earnings. What is the job outlook for radiology technicians in Washington?

The job outlook for a radiology career in Washington is promising, with a projected national growth rate of about 9% between 2022 and 2032. This growth is largely driven by an aging population requiring increased medical imaging services and ongoing technological advancements in the field. Urban centers such as Seattle, Spokane, and Tacoma offer ample employment opportunities, while rural areas may face limitations due to smaller healthcare infrastructures, potentially affecting job availability.

Demand for radiology technicians in Washington is also influenced by workforce retirements and the expansion of outpatient diagnostic centers, which diversify the types of available positions beyond traditional hospital settings. This shift may require technicians to adapt by developing specialized skills in imaging procedures like MRI and CT scanning, which often provide better pay and greater job security. Which industries provide the best opportunities for radiology technicians?

Radiology technicians in Washington can choose from several industries that affect salary, benefits, and work conditions. Below are the primary sectors offering strong opportunities:

  • Hospitals: Hospitals provide stable salaries averaging around seventy-five thousand dollars per year and offer robust benefits, including pension plans, but often involve shift work and high patient volumes.
  • Outpatient Care Centers and Private Diagnostic Imaging Firms: These settings typically offer competitive pay, performance bonuses, and more regular daytime hours, appealing to those who value work-life balance and career advancement.
  • Nonprofit Organizations: Nonprofits focus on patient-centered care and may provide loan forgiveness or tuition reimbursement, though salaries tend to be lower compared to corporate or government roles.
  • Government Jobs, Including Veterans Affairs Medical Centers: Government positions offer predictable schedules, comprehensive benefits, and job security, but may be less dynamic in adopting new technologies.

What are the latest trends and emerging technologies in radiology?

Radiology is advancing rapidly, and today’s technicians in Washington must stay current with key innovations. Below are the latest trends shaping the field and the essential skills they require.

  • Artificial Intelligence Integration: AI tools assist with image analysis and improve diagnostic accuracy, but technicians must understand how to use them effectively without losing clinical judgment.
  • Digital Imaging and PACS Systems: Modern radiology relies on Picture Archiving and Communication Systems (PACS), so managing digital workflows and troubleshooting issues is now a core part of the job.
  • Telemedicine and Remote Imaging: Technicians often work with off-site radiologists, making clear digital communication and data sharing skills increasingly important.
  • Advanced CT and MRI Technologies: As machines become more complex, technicians need hands-on training to operate new systems and interpret real-time data.
  • Cybersecurity Awareness: Protecting patient data is critical, and technicians must follow security protocols when handling sensitive digital files.
  • 3D Imaging and Printing: Some facilities use 3D imaging for surgical planning, and technicians may assist in preparing data for these purposes.

What career and professional development opportunities exist for radiology technicians in Washington?

Radiology technicians in Washington have several healthcare career paths available for advancement and professional development, though opportunities may vary by location. Here are five key development paths:

1. Specialization Certifications

Radiology technicians can pursue specialized certifications in areas like computed tomography (CT), magnetic resonance imaging (MRI), or mammography. These certifications enhance skills and open doors to higher-paying jobs and advanced responsibilities. However, the cost and time commitment required for these certifications can be a barrier, especially for those balancing work and personal commitments.

2. Continuing Education Requirements

Washington mandates continuing education for radiology technicians to maintain licensure, ensuring professionals stay updated with evolving technology and safety standards. Courses often cover new imaging techniques and regulatory updates. While essential, access to affordable, high-quality continuing education can be challenging for those living in rural areas or working irregular hours.

3. Support from Professional Organizations

Organizations like the Washington State Society of Radiologic Technologists (WSSRT) offer workshops, seminars, and networking events. These opportunities help technicians stay connected with industry trends, build professional relationships, and access career resources. Active involvement in such groups can enhance professional visibility and open up mentorship opportunities.

4. Employer-Sponsored Training and Tuition Assistance

Major healthcare employers such as UW Medicine and Providence Health & Services often provide tuition reimbursement, in-house training, and support for certification programs. This assistance helps reduce the financial burden of further education and encourages skill development, though such benefits may not be equally available at smaller or rural healthcare facilities.

5. Career Advancement to Supervisory or Educational Roles

Experienced radiology technicians in Washington may advance into supervisory positions, clinical educator roles, or administrative jobs. These roles typically require additional leadership training or advanced certifications, but offer opportunities for increased responsibility and salary. Advancement depends on local employer needs and individual commitment to professional growth.

How fast can you become a radiology technician in Washington?

You can become a radiology technician in Washington in about 2.5 to 3 years. This includes completing a two-year associate degree, preparing for and passing the ARRT exam, and obtaining state licensure, which takes 1–2 months. Accelerated programs may shorten this timeline slightly, but quality training and preparation are essential. Factors like program choice, study habits, and prompt application submission significantly impact how quickly you can enter the workforce.

Which radiology technician gets paid the most?

Interventional Radiology Technologists typically earn the highest salaries among radiology technicians in Washington, often over $90,000 annually. These roles involve assisting in complex, image-guided procedures in hospitals and specialized centers. MRI and CT Technologists also command high pay, averaging around $85,000–$87,000. Specialization, certification, and work setting all influence pay. While salary is important, consider work-life balance, environment, and job satisfaction when choosing a radiology career path.

What is the fastest path to radiology technician?

The fastest path to becoming a radiology technician is through an accelerated certificate or diploma program, which can be completed in 12 to 18 months. These programs offer intensive coursework and clinical experience, preparing students for the ARRT certification and Washington licensure. However, they require strong time management and dedication. Ensure any program you choose is JRCERT-accredited and meets state requirements to avoid certification delays and maximize job opportunities upon graduation.

What major is best for radiology technician?

The best major for becoming a radiology technician is an Associate of Applied Science (AAS) in Radiologic Technology or Radiography. These programs teach imaging procedures, anatomy, patient care, and safety. Accredited programs recognized by JRCERT ensure eligibility for the ARRT exam and Washington licensure. Strong clinical training and local job alignment are key. Choosing a reputable, accredited program improves your chances of certification, employment, and long-term success in Washington’s healthcare field.
